Regeneration of surface acid sites via mild oxidation on dehydration catalysts
Catalysis Science & Technology Pub Date : 03/31/2016 00:00:00 , DOI:10.1039/C6CY00510A
Abstract

This work reports novel experimental evidence for the use of mild oxidation conditions to remove humin deposits on active xylose dehydration catalysts that showed deactivation. The catalytic regeneration experiments carried out at 70 °C using iron precursors as catalysts and H2O2 as an oxidant show that the catalysts achieve 95% acid site regeneration using the Fenton chemistry.
